Size,Morphology And Influence Factors Of Polymer Aggregates In Water

Polymer flooding has a wide range of applications in enhanced oil recovery.The polymers used in polymer flooding mostly are high molecular polymers.It exists in the form of molecular coils in aqueous solutions.The size and morphology of polymer molecular coils will change with the solution concentration,polymer molecular weight,salinity,temperature and other parameters.The change of polymer aggregation morphology will obvious influence on the fluidity of the polymer solution,which will lead to changes the water and oil flow velocity ratio and the conformance efficiency,and then affect the oil recovery.On the other hand,there is a size matching problem between molecular coil formed by polymer in the solution and the pore throat of reservoir.If the matching is poor,oil-displacing effect will also decrease.In order to promote polymer flooding to newly developed low permeability oilfield and ultra-low permeability oilfield.The size and shape of polymer molecular coils in water are systematically studied.To this end,this article conducted a series of studies and some significant results have been obtained:1.Firstly,by improving the existing sample preparation method of transmission electron microscope,a method for detecting the morphology of polymer aggregates in aqueous solution and a sample preparation tool have been developed.The method has the advantages of operation simple,low cost,multiple samples can be prepared at the same time,and detection period is short,etc.With this sample preparation method,the aggregation morphology of the polymer in water can be observed intuitively.2.The aggregation behavior of ultra-high molecular weight polyacrylamide in water was systematically studied by laser light scattering and TEM.It was found that the size of the molecular coils formed by polymers in water decreased with the increase of molecular weight,and the morphologies of polymer molecular coils with different molecular weight were significantly different.Temperature has little effect on the size of polymer molecular coils.There is little difference in the aggregation morphology at different temperatures,all of which are sheet-like structures.Under acidic conditions,the size of polymer molecular coils is relatively large,and under alkaline conditions,the size of molecular coils is relatively small,and does not change significantly with the change of p H value.Under acidic conditions,the polymer aggregated form of polymer presents a rosary-like structure,while under alkaline conditions it transforms into a sheet-like structure.There is no linear relationship between salinity and particle size of polymer molecular coils.When the sodium chloride concentration is low,the polymer aggregates form worm-like structure,and when the sodium chloride concentration is high,it turns into sheet-like structure.Different kinds of salts have different effects on the size of polymer molecular coils,and Fe3+significantly increases the size of molecular coils.When different kinds of salts in the water,the aggregation morphology of the polymer are obviously different.3.The application of small-angle scattering(SASX)in polymer aggregation behavior is initially discussed.The experimental results show that the aggregation form of polyacrylamide molecules in the solution is spherical structure,with rotation radius of 8.68nm and Dmax of 25 nm,which is in good agreement with the data obtained by laser light scattering and TEM.It can be seen that it is feasible to extend the application of small-angle scattering technology to the study of polymer aggregation behavior.
